twilson37 Posted February 3, 2021 Posted February 3, 2021 (edited) 57 minutes ago, Mario30 said: I hope P-38 will have escorts The thing is they shouldn't need it. In 1944 the Luftwaffe was averaging less than 400 Fighter sorties per day in NW Europe. The USAAF 9th air force alone was more than double not to mention the 2nd TAW and the 8th AF. Most Allied pilots rarely saw German fighters, furthermore many Luftwaffe pilots were poorly trained, rather than have escorts they should simply reduce the likelihood of being intercepted and randomize the number and location of attackers when they do. In reality Allied fighter planes face far greater threats from Flak than enemy aircraft. Edited February 3, 2021 by twilson37
